2) Getting Anope running depends on your operating system.

For Windows:
- Extract all the files to c:\anope
- Make a services.conf (there is an example.conf somewhere)
- Run the exe.

For *NIX:
- Extract the files fromt he tarball.
- Run ./Config
- Run make
- Run make install
- Make a services.conf (there is an example.conf in dir you told it to install to)
- Start the services by typing ./services
